Capt Elder Preserved CLAPP 1643–1720 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: November 23, 1643
Birth Location: Dorchester, Suffolk, Massachusetts, USA
Death Date: September 22, 1720
Death Location: Northampton, Hampshire, Massachusetts, USA
Father: Captain Clapp
Mother: Johanna (Clapp)
Spouse(s): Sarah Newberry
Children(s): Wait Taylor
The story of Capt Elder Preserved CLAPP began in 1643 in Dorchester, Suffolk, Massachusetts, USA. Capt Elder Preserved CLAPP married Sarah Newberry, and had children including Wait Taylor. Capt Elder Preserved CLAPP passed away in 1720 in Northampton, Hampshire, Massachusetts, USA.
